The cost of living in Douala is 142% more expensive than in Kano. Cities ranked 4344th and 8160th ($1363 vs $563) in the list of the most expensive cities in the world and ranked 1st and 28th in Cameroon and Nigeria, respectively. Check Cameroon vs Nigeria comparison.

The average after-tax salary is enough to cover living expenses for 0.1 months in Douala compared to 0.1 months in Kano. Douala ranked 1st best city to live in Cameroon vs Kano ranked 21st in Nigeria, while ranked 7753rd and 9173rd among best cities to live in the world.
